What started as a simple daily photograph quickly expanded. By the 1980s and 1990s, Page 3 had become a powerful launching pad for young women looking to break into the entertainment industry. Models like Samantha Fox, Linda Lusardi, and later Katie Price (Jordan) became household names, proving that Page 3 was not just a photo opportunity, but a career catalyst. Achieving Page 3 status served as a direct passport into the broader British entertainment ecosystem. Models became permanent fixtures in the 1980s and 1990s tabloid culture. They frequently attended high-profile movie premieres, VIP nightclub launches, and charity sports events, establishing themselves as mainstream socialites. The Page 3 Girl phenomenon remains one of the most culturally polarizing chapters in modern media history. Originating in the UK’s The Sun newspaper in 1970, the daily feature of a topless glamour model transformed from a simple circulation booster into a multi-million-pound lifestyle and entertainment ecosystem. For over four decades, it defined a specific brand of British working-class entertainment, launched mainstream celebrity careers, and created a distinct blueprint for the glamour industry.
